What is a blue ocean job?

A Blue Ocean job refers to a role in an emerging or innovative industry where competition is minimal, creating new market opportunities. These jobs often require creative problem-solving, adaptability, and a forward-thinking mindset. Unlike traditional roles in highly competitive industries (Red Ocean jobs), Blue Ocean jobs focus on groundbreaking ideas, technologies, or business models. They can be found in fields such as AI, renewable energy, and disruptive tech. Pursuing a Blue Ocean job allows professionals to shape industries rather than compete within existing ones.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a blue ocean strategist,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Blue Ocean strategist, you need strong analytical thinking, strategic planning, and a background in business or marketing, often supported by an MBA or similar qualification. Familiarity with strategic frameworks like the Blue Ocean Strategy Canvas and tools such as SWOT analysis and industry trend platforms is typical. Creativity, open-mindedness, and strong communication skills help professionals identify untapped market opportunities and drive innovation. These skills and qualities are crucial for developing unique value propositions and enabling organizations to break away from competition.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in blue ocean strategy roles, and how can they be addressed?

Professionals in Blue Ocean strategy roles often face the challenge of driving innovation within organizations that are accustomed to traditional, competitive markets. Gaining buy-in from stakeholders for unconventional ideas can be difficult, as can identifying truly untapped market opportunities. To overcome these challenges, it’s important to use data-driven research, foster cross-functional collaboration, and communicate the long-term value of Blue Ocean initiatives. Regularly engaging with different departments and presenting clear business cases helps build support and ensures alignment throughout the process.
